Commercial Concrete Painting in Pinellas County, FL

Commercial concrete painting services involve applying high-quality coatings to existing concrete surfaces, including driveways, parking lots, warehouse floors, and storefronts. These services are designed to enhance the appearance, improve durability, and provide clear markings or signage for commercial properties. Property owners often request concrete painting to create a clean, professional look, increase safety with visible lines or warnings, or to refresh worn or faded surfaces, making them more attractive and functional for daily use.

Before requesting concrete painting services, property owners should consider the condition of the existing concrete surface, including any cracks, chips, or stains that may need repair prior to painting. It’s also important to understand the type of coating used, its suitability for the specific application, and the expected longevity of the finish. Pro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and sealing, is essential for achieving a lasting result, and property owners should inquire about the process to ensure the project meets their needs and expectations.

Common Commercial Concrete Painting Jobs

Parking Garages - durable painting solutions to protect concrete surfaces in high-traffic areas.

Warehouse Floors - protective coatings that enhance appearance and resist wear in commercial storage spaces.

Loading Docks - slip-resistant and weather-resistant coatings designed for heavy-duty use.

Retail Spaces - vibrant, long-lasting concrete paint to improve storefront appeal and customer experience.

Industrial Facilities - specialized coatings to withstand harsh conditions and extend concrete lifespan.

Service Bays - functional finishes that resist oil, chemicals, and frequent cleaning.

Commercial Concrete Painting Questions

What types of concrete surfaces can be painted? Commercial concrete painting can be applied to driveways, parking lots, warehouse floors, and outdoor walkways to enhance durability and appearance.

Is surface preparation important before painting? Yes, proper cleaning and surface repairs are essential to ensure the paint adheres well and lasts longer.

What finishes are available for concrete painting? Finishes range from matte to gloss, allowing property owners to choose based on aesthetic preferences and functional needs.

How long does concrete paint typically last? The lifespan of concrete paint depends on usage and maintenance but generally provides several years of protection and visual appeal.
